UPVC Window Repair Near Me

Windows are an important element of every home. They block out water, air and noise as well as contaminants. Over time, they may become damaged or faulty. In certain instances, these issues may require professional repairs to fix them.

UPVC windows are becoming popular due to their strength and low-maintenance requirements. They also help you save money on your energy bill.

Repair of window locks made of UPVC

uPVC is a preferred choice for new and renovation projects. These windows have many advantages like durability, ease of maintenance, and energy efficiency. These windows are BPAand UPVC Window Repair Near Me phthalate-free, making them safe for children. They are also rustproof, and do not require painting or varnishing to keep looking at their best. They are also resistant to rot, warp, or leak, and are easy to clean. However, despite their strength and ease of maintenance, occasionally your uPVC windows may develop issues that require professional attention. This could be a draughty or broken window or a damaged lock or a broken handle.

uPVC window and door locks can become damaged over the years due to wear and tears or accidental damage. They can become less secure and more susceptible to break-ins. It is therefore important to repair the components as soon as you are able to. Fortunately, you can accomplish this by contacting a local double-glazing specialist. This type of expert is skilled to do a variety of repairs and upgrades to uPVC windows and doors. They may also suggest other security products, such as letterbox guards and door viewers.

A gap between the frame of the sash and the frame could be the reason for your windows not closing properly. This can lead to draughts, however it could also cause water damage and damp. You can test this by placing an item of paper between the sash frame and the sash to see whether the sash can be shut.

To fix the issue, you'll need to take off the seals around the frame and the sash. Then, you'll need to remove the locking gearbox from its place inside the frame. To open the gearbox, you will need an open-ended screwdriver or torch. After removing the gearbox you will need to replace it with an alternative of similar in size and shape.

You can also employ an expert local to assist you in fixing the uPVC window lock. They will have all the tools needed for the job that they will bring with them. They will also be familiar with the various types of uPVC windows and can identify yours by phone. They will be able to diagnose your problem quickly and give you an estimate for repair work.
